Form 4: Trump Media & Technology Group CEO Devin Nunes Disposes of Shares to Cover Tax Withholdings
SEC Form 4 Filing
CEO Devin Nunes disposed of 179,291 shares of Trump Media & Technology Group Corp. to cover the company's withholding payments to taxing authorities.
Summary
- On February 20, 2025, Devin G. Nunes, CEO, President, and Chairman of Trump Media & Technology Group Corp., disposed of 179,291 shares of common stock at a price of $27.84 per share.
- The transaction was executed to cover the Issuer's withholding payments to applicable taxing authorities.
- Following the transaction, Nunes directly owns 1,208,188 shares, some of which are restricted stock units (RSUs) representing a contingent right to receive one share of common stock subject to vesting conditions.
